通信云IM如何支持实时语音识别和语音合成?

随着互联网技术的飞速发展,即时通讯(IM)已经成为人们日常生活中不可或缺的一部分。在IM领域,实时语音识别和语音合成技术越来越受到重视,它们为用户提供了更加便捷、高效的沟通方式。本文将探讨通信云IM如何支持实时语音识别和语音合成,以及它们在实际应用中的优势。

一、实时语音识别技术

实时语音识别(Real-time Speech Recognition,RTSR)是将语音信号实时转换为文本信息的技术。在通信云IM中,实时语音识别技术可以实现以下功能:

  1. 语音输入:用户可以通过语音输入消息,无需手动打字,提高沟通效率。

  2. 语音搜索:用户可以通过语音搜索关键词,快速找到所需信息。

  3. 语音翻译:实时语音识别技术可以支持多语言语音识别,实现跨语言沟通。

  4. 语音控制:用户可以通过语音控制IM软件,实现一键操作。

实时语音识别技术的实现主要依赖于以下几个关键环节:

(1)语音采集:通过麦克风采集用户语音信号。

(2)语音预处理:对采集到的语音信号进行降噪、增强等处理,提高语音质量。

(3)特征提取:从预处理后的语音信号中提取特征参数,如梅尔频率倒谱系数(MFCC)等。

(4)模型训练:利用大量标注数据进行模型训练,提高识别准确率。

(5)解码与输出:将识别结果转换为文本信息,输出给用户。

二、实时语音合成技术

实时语音合成(Real-time Speech Synthesis,RTSS)是将文本信息实时转换为语音信号的技术。在通信云IM中,实时语音合成技术可以实现以下功能:

  1. 语音输出:将文本消息转换为语音,方便用户收听。

  2. 语音播报:实时播报新闻、天气等信息,提供个性化服务。

  3. 语音导航:为用户提供语音导航服务,如路线规划、景点介绍等。

实时语音合成技术的实现主要依赖于以下几个关键环节:

  1. 文本处理:对输入的文本信息进行分词、词性标注等处理。

  2. 语音参数生成:根据文本信息生成相应的语音参数,如音素、音调、语速等。

  3. 合成引擎:利用语音合成引擎将语音参数转换为语音信号。

  4. 语音后处理:对生成的语音信号进行降噪、增强等处理,提高语音质量。

  5. 输出与播放:将处理后的语音信号输出给用户,通过扬声器播放。

三、通信云IM支持实时语音识别和语音合成的优势

  1. 提高沟通效率:实时语音识别和语音合成技术可以节省用户打字时间,提高沟通效率。

  2. 便捷性:用户无需手动操作,即可实现语音输入、语音输出等功能,提高使用便捷性。

  3. 个性化服务:通过实时语音识别和语音合成技术,IM软件可以为用户提供个性化服务,如语音播报、语音导航等。

  4. 跨语言沟通:实时语音识别和语音合成技术支持多语言处理,实现跨语言沟通。

  5. 智能化发展:随着技术的不断进步,实时语音识别和语音合成技术将更加智能化,为用户提供更加丰富的功能。

总之,通信云IM支持实时语音识别和语音合成技术具有广泛的应用前景。随着技术的不断发展和完善,实时语音识别和语音合成技术将为用户带来更加便捷、高效的沟通体验。在未来,我们可以期待更多创新应用的出现,为人们的生活带来更多便利。

猜你喜欢:环信超级社区